A true culture of health and safety relies not only on a strong safety program, but also on one that focuses on worker well-being. Members of the Campbell Institute at the National Safety Council already have signed on to this belief, which is why many have had worker well-being programs in place for several years. A new white paper from the Campbell Institute highlights this emerging topic that is quickly gaining momentum.
